Mobile Capabilities

Mobile access is going from important to essential. Can the collaboration system be accessed from mobile devices? Which mobile operating systems does it support? Is there any loss of functionality when accessing the platform from a mobile device? How well does the user interface adapt to each platform?

Appian says its platform, which combines aspects of social and business process management software, lets developers write apps that can be deployed on any platform. Here you see Appian on the iPhone, showcasing the platform's ability to take business action (approve a purchase request) directly from a social interface.
